House Siding Replacement in Norwalk, CT
House siding replacement services involve removing existing exterior siding and installing new material to enhance the appearance, durability, and energy efficiency of a home. This service covers a variety of siding types, such as vinyl, fiber cement, wood, or composite materials, and can address issues like damage, aging, or outdated styles. Property owners typically seek siding replacement when their current siding is cracked, warped, or faded, or when they want to improve curb appeal and protect the home from weather elements.
Before requesting siding replacement, homeowners usually want to understand the scope of work involved, including the types of siding available and the expected benefits. It’s important to consider factors such as the condition of the existing structure, the compatibility of new siding with the home’s design, and any necessary repairs to underlying surfaces. Clarifying these details can help ensure the project meets expectations for both appearance and performance.

House Siding Replacement Questions
What are common signs that house siding needs replacement? Visible damage, such as cracking, warping, or excessive fading, can indicate siding deterioration requiring replacement.
What types of siding materials are available for replacement? Options include vinyl, fiber cement, wood, and aluminum, each offering different durability and aesthetic qualities.
How does replacing siding improve a home's exterior? Replacement enhances curb appeal, protects against weather elements, and can increase property value.
What should property owners consider before choosing siding replacement? Factors include the home's style, local climate, maintenance needs, and personal aesthetic preferences.
